WebJun 16, 2024 · Objectives: A nurse duty roster is usually prepared monthly in a hospital ward. It is common for nurses to make duty shift requests prior to scheduling. A ward manager normally spends more than a working day to manually prepare and subsequently to optimally adjust the schedule upon staff requests and hospital policies. camp hidden valley white hall md https://toppropertiesamarillo.com

WebSelf-rostering at one extreme, is conducive to staff empowerment, motivation and roster effectiveness, whilst departmental rostering, at the other, leads to perceived autocracy, reduced empowerment, lower levels of staff motivation and roster effectiveness. Manage hospital floor inventory ... first united methodist church humble txWebNov 19, 2024 · Lead team members were trained in how to collect nurses’ work-life preferences, and how to produce the roster. Members of staff from each band gathered the preferences in one-to-one discussions. Lead team members produced the roster. It was then finalised by the ward manager, who made any changes necessary before final approval. first united methodist church in boerne txWebJul 1, 2024 · Usually, nursing manager spends a substantial amount of time developing rosters for many staff requests, and for ad hoc changes to current duty rosters.
